River Ranch is comprised of approximately 48,000 square acres,
roughly 70 square miles. The best part about River Ranch is that it is private
property and there is a property owner's association setup to maintain
and help improve your enjoyment of the property. You can see some of

The property was setup and sold in the late 1960's by Gulf
America Corporation as property to be best used for hunting,
primitive camping and recreational use and that is what we still
have today. You can not build your dream home here. Camps have to be
kept movable. Trailers up to 40 feet long and 10 feet wide are
allowed to be used. Electric is generator, solar, wind powered only.
For over 30 years, participating River Ranch property owners
have used what is considered a safe camping area. Instead of having
camps all over the entire 70 squares miles, it was decided a safe
camping area confined to aproximately 7-9 square miles would allow
for better use of the hunting/riding areas. You do not want camps
all over the 70 square miles. Members have always shared their
property, which in turn gives us the ability to enjoy all the
property.
Membership
Membership to the RRPOA is $120 a year per person 16 years of age
and older using a recreational vehicle. Memberships run from March
1st-Feb 28th of each year. Each paid member can purchase up to 2
guest passes, which run concurrent with membership. In order to get
an assigned campsite, you have to own 1.25 acres minimum. The RRPOA
suggests that 1-4 people or married couples can be on a 1.25 acre
deed and only 1 person or 1 married couple can be on a .31 acre
deed. The .31 acre deed gets you recreational use of the property
and use of the temporary camping area, where what you bring out to
camp with, must leave with you.
